Premium Hotels in City of Johannesburg
Birnam
Dunkeld
Morningside
Chartwell
Rosebank
Ferndale
Sandown
Norwood
Saint Andrews
Sandton
You are booking hotel for more than 30 days
Edenburg, City of Johannesburg
Birnam
Dunkeld
Morningside
Chartwell
Rosebank
Ferndale
Sandown
Norwood
Saint Andrews
Sandton
Saint Andrews
Sandton
Birnam
Birnam
Hyde Park
Sandton
Observatory
Houghton Estate
Strathavon
Wendywood
Morningside
Bryanston
Magaliessig
Birnam
Rosebank
Saint Andrews
Randpark
Illovo
Edenburg
Norwood